Answer:
the copper ion in the solution is light blue and the Cu(NH3)4+2 is a deep blue. The question asks if there are 3 tubes, in which the first one contains only copper ions, what was added to produce the deep blue colour? For this question, I believe that NH3 was added to the solution.

What is tetraaminecopper.?
This dark blue to purple solid is a salt of the metal complex [Cu (NH 3) 4 (H 2 O)] 2+. It is closely related to Schweizer's reagent, which is used for the production of cellulose fibers in the production of rayon.
